European Roes Aquatic Animals Production in Capture Fisheries by Country

The production value of European Roes Aquatic Animals in capture fisheries varies significantly across countries. As of 2023, Norway leads with the highest value of 5.6 million euros, followed by Denmark and Sweden. The UK, Portugal, Netherlands, and Belgium trail behind with lower values. Notably, in 2023, Portugal and the Netherlands showed strong growth of 8.88% and 30.32%, respectively, indicating potential emerging markets. Denmark also witnessed steady growth at 7.9%, reflecting sustained industry improvements. Norway's growth remains moderate at 2.0%. In contrast, Sweden's growth stagnated in 2023, reflecting possible market maturation or challenges.
